Technical Service Bulletins, or TSBs, are recommended procedures for repairing vehicles. They are a form of diagnosis. Not to be confused with recalls, a TSB is issued by a vehicle manufacturer when there are several occurrences of an unanticipated problem. TSBs can range from vehicle-specific to covering entire product lines and break down the specified repair into a step-by-step process. While sometimes written by engineers employed by OEMs, the majority are authored by the first automotive technician to come up with a repair procedure. Because certain problems may have more than one cause and there is sometimes more than one way to fix a problem, it's somewhat common for there to be more than one TSB for the same problem.
One major difference between a recall and a TSB in the automotive industry is that a recall usually evolves out of safety issues at the behest of an organization like the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). The ensuing recall maintenance/repair work is usually done at no charge to the car owner, regardless of the car's warranty status. Dealers are usually under no mandate to call in cars for which there are TSBs to do the related repairs. Nor is there an obligation to do the TSB repairs for free or at reduced charges to the owner, since the manufacture does not require the repair to be performed and does not reimburse the dealership for repairs. When the vehicle's manufacturer releases a recall, they not only require the dealership to perform the repair, but will reimburse them the recall's repair.
Some benefits of an automotive TSB are that by widely circulating among dealership service departments and mechanics an engineering-level description and solution for a problem common to type, year, make or model of car, a well-managed TSB process can save technicians troubleshooting time; provide organized, itemized repair procedures; and standardize the repair process. This can also enhance the quality of the maintenance since it tends to be supported by repair history and high-level diagnostic procedure decisions.

Indeed, shall One go, as told in my preceding posts, to the NHTSA site and call for a recall campaign, the related documents, including the SB are also listed and available for download i.e.: SB 1800 # 20 related to the recall campaign 11V567000 (pictures above), SB1800  #22 related to the recall campaign 14V47200 and SB1800 #23 related to Recall Campaign 15V700000 as examples. 

Notes: 
- Recall Campaign 14V47200 and the associated SB 1800 #22 mentioned in my previous post here are no longer available for download on the NHTSA site since they are superseded by the recall 15V700000 which is taking place nowadays
- The SB 1800 # 23 related to the current recall campaign 15V700000 is a Interim one, as stated on the document (and reason why I am interested in getting the final SB...)

As an additional information, please be informed that this page NHTSA is listing 8 related documents to the recall campaign 15V700000 (right part of the page) : The SB (Interim) 1800 # 23 can be read among them.
